From its premium master-grade tonewoods to specs like the neck profile and string spacing, this OM-C was crafted by luthier Jeff Jewitt with the fingerstylist in mind. It's a little deeper than a standard OM at 4-1/2", which brings added bass punch and presence. Jeff has harnessed the best elements of cedar, with its warmth and strong mid-range, and given it clarity, focus, and sweet trebles by pairing it with cocobolo. The end result is a complex, enveloping voice that stands beautifully on its own.
Gold EVO frets, Gotoh 510 tuners and a comfortable "fingerstyle C" neck shape contribute to the player's experience, while ebony binding and a simple B/W/B purfling scheme, along with a clean abalone rosette, give this guitar an elegant finishing touch.
